Added code to detect if the working directory file system is one that supports symlinks so that we won't try to do symlink processing when the platform does not support it. check-in: 5d251b6739 user: sdr tags: winsymlink
04:08
Modified the win/include/dirent.h file to #undef _DIRENT_HAVE_D_TYPE. With that define fossil tries to use info from opendir/readdir to detect symbolic links unsucessfully. By using undef we force fossil to go through a different route which successfully detects symbolic links. check-in: db2128fa24 user: sdr tags: winsymlink

Changed the inherited privilege markers from prefixed bullet characters to suffixed subscripted letters to help better differentiate which privileges are inherited for users with color perception difficulties. The color coding is still present as it doesn't hurt to have color coding, just needed extra indications on the page. Closed-Leaf check-in: 7b00cd77a0 user: sdr tags: inherit-priv-mark-sub
